Transaction f81971dcf66cf912a60a21d6cf91d3e75ef47d07757c26b01c81888d2ecfc729

2 Input
2 Outputs
  • f81971dcf66cf912a60a21d6cf91d3e75ef47d07757c26b01c81888d2ecfc729:0
  • value  238423162
    address  3Hh1QFxhoZuruKDk93Vxqr3Hdr7QuUeP1E
  • f81971dcf66cf912a60a21d6cf91d3e75ef47d07757c26b01c81888d2ecfc729:1
  • value  1520000
    address  18WkaP7qtAyJnPvakzkHnir9RE9hYrC6xf